Spectacular Highlights of the Day Tour to the Nubian Museum Journey
- The Nubian Museum Exploration: A comprehensive tour of one of Egypt’s most significant museums, covering thousands of years of Nubian and Egyptian history.
- UNESCO Rescue Campaign Insight: A detailed look at the 1960s international effort that saved the monuments of Nubia from the flooding of Lake Nasser.
- Pharaonic & Nubian Artifacts: Access to a vast collection of recovered objects, including statues, stelae, and everyday items from ancient settlements.
- The High Dam Exhibits: Specialized displays featuring artifacts salvaged specifically from the sites surrounding the Aswan High Dam.
- Traditional Village Architecture: Appreciation of the museum’s unique design, which won the Aga Khan Award for Architecture for its cultural resonance.
- Botanical Garden & Waterfalls: A stroll through the 43,000 square meters of gardens featuring local flora, natural rocks, and a scenic amphitheater.
- Prehistoric Discoveries: Observation of tools and rock art that date back to the earliest human inhabitants of the Nile Valley.
- Private Egyptologist Guidance: In-depth interpretation of the most significant artifacts provided by a professional expert throughout the tour.

Tour Itinerary
The professional Day Tour to the Nubian Museum expedition begins with a private pick-up from your Aswan accommodation in a modern, air-conditioned vehicle. Upon arrival at the museum, the first phase of the itinerary focuses on a high-authority guided tour of the indoor galleries. Your Egyptologist guide will lead you through chronological displays, starting with prehistoric rock art and moving into the complex relationship between Nubian kings and Egyptian Pharaohs. You will receive expert insight into the most significant pieces, including royal statuary and Christian-era frescoes saved from the floodwaters. This phase is designed to provide a sovereign understanding of the UNESCO rescue mission's magnitude, ensuring you appreciate the technical expertise required to relocate these treasures before the opening of the High Dam.
The second half of your Day Tour to the Nubian Museum itinerary shifts to the award-winning exterior and the vast botanical grounds. The high-authority plan includes a walk through the 43,000 square meters of landscaped gardens, where you will observe the architectural design intended to mimic traditional Nubian dwellings. You will have sovereign leisure time to explore the sequence of waterfalls and the open-air amphitheater at your own pace, allowing for personal reflection on the cultural narratives presented in the galleries. The tour concludes with a comfortable private transfer back to your hotel or Nile Cruise, providing a peerless window into the heritage of the Nile Valley and completing your comprehensive cultural immersion in Aswan.
